CIT106 — Principles of Ethical Hacking

3 credits · 3 hours

3 Credit(s) This course is designed to introduce concepts of hacking computers, networks, and web applications from the perspective of a hacker with hands on labs and exercises to truly experience the emerging threats of cybersecurity and their mitigations. Includes the introduction for various cyber security trends and pathways such as network security, application security and policy management.

Prerequisites: CIT142, CIT220
